Smarter NPCs Transforming Gameplay

Non-Playable Characters (NPCs) are no longer just background figures. With AI, they can react and adapt to players in real-time. This makes the gaming experience more immersive. Imagine an NPC that remembers your choices and alters their behavior accordingly. This adds depth to storytelling and gameplay.

– 🔹 Dynamic Interactions: NPCs can respond to player actions differently. If you help one character, others might react positively or negatively. This creates a living world where your choices matter.
– 🔹 Learning from Players: AI can analyze player behavior. NPCs can learn and adjust their strategies, making them feel more human-like. This unpredictability keeps players engaged longer.

Creating Lifelike Environments

AI is also enhancing game worlds. Environments are becoming more realistic and interactive. This helps players feel like they are part of the game.

– 🔹 Procedural Generation: AI can create vast landscapes and intricate details on the fly. This means every player can experience something unique. Imagine exploring a forest that changes with each playthrough.
– 🔹 Adaptive Weather Systems: AI can simulate weather changes that impact gameplay. Rain might make surfaces slippery, while fog could limit visibility. These details add layers to the gaming experience.

Personalizing Player Experiences

AI isn’t just about smarter NPCs and environments. It’s also about tailoring experiences to individual players.

– 🔹 Custom Difficulty Levels: AI can adjust the game’s difficulty based on player performance. If you’re struggling, the game can become easier. If you’re breezing through, it can ramp up the challenge.
– 🔹 Personalized Storylines: Some games use AI to create story arcs based on player choices. This means no two players have the same journey, keeping the experience fresh and exciting.

Challenges of AI in Game Development

While AI offers many benefits, it also comes with challenges.

– 🔹 Balancing AI Behavior: Developers must ensure that AI doesn’t become too predictable or too difficult. Finding that sweet spot is crucial for player satisfaction.
– 🔹 Ethical Considerations: As AI grows smarter, developers must consider how it affects gameplay. How much should NPCs remember? What are the implications for player privacy?
